Summary

The first-ever weight-loss plan specifically designed to stop—and reverse—age-related weight gain and muscle loss, while shrinking your belly, extending your life, and creating your healthiest self at mid-life and beyond.

You don’t have to gain weight as you age. That’s the simple yet revolutionary promise of The Whole Body Reset, which uncovers why standard diet and exercise advice stops working for us as we approach midlife—and reveals how simple changes to the way we eat can stop, and even reverse, age-related weight gain and muscle loss.

The Whole Body Reset presents stunning new evidence about the power of “protein timing” for people at midlife—research that blows away the current government guidelines and changes the way people in their mid-forties and older should think about food. The Whole Body Reset explains in simple, inspiring, and entertaining terms exactly how our bodies change with age, and how eating to accommodate those changes can make us respond to exercise as if we were twenty to thirty years younger.

Developed by AARP, tested by a panel of more than 100 AARP employees, and approved by an international board of doctors, nutrition, and fitness experts, The Whole Body Reset doesn’t use diet phases, eating windows, calorie restriction, or other trendy gimmicks. Its six simple secrets and scores of recipes are family-friendly and easy to follow, designed for real people living in the real world. An easy dining guide even shows how to follow this program in popular restaurants from McDonald’s to Starbucks to Olive Garden. And best of all: It works!

Author Biography

Stephen Perrine has crafted more than two dozen New York Times bestsellers as an author, editor, or publisher. As Executive Editor for AARP the Magazine and the AARP Bulletin, he oversees health and wellness coverage reaching more than 38 million readers. He is the creator, editor, and publisher of the Eat This, Not That! book series, and coauthor, with Danica Patrick, of Pretty Intense. Perrine is the cocreator of Better Man, a nationally syndicated health and wellness TV show for men. The former editor-in-chief of Best Life and editorial creative director of Men’s Health, he has appeared as a nutrition expert on programs including Dr. Oz, Today, Good Morning America, and the 700 Club. He lives in New York.

A nutritionist and exercise scientist, Heidi Skolnik has appeared on the Today show, Live! With Kelly and Ryan, and the Food Network. She oversees Performance Nutrition at the School of American Ballet and The Julliard School. She previously served as the team nutritionist for the New York Giants, New York Knicks, and New York Mets. She sits on the advisory board of the National Menopause Foundation and served as a board member for the National Osteoporosis Foundation for ten years. She is the author of Grill Yourself Skinny and coauthor of Nutrient Timing for Peak Performance and The Reverse Diet. She lives in New Jersey.

AARP, with 38 million members, is the nation’s largest nonprofit, nonpartisan organization dedicated to empowering people to choose how they live as they age.
